I read on Halopedia you can get a glimpse of a Flood-infected human very early on in the swamps, I never saw him but did hear him groan. Aside from the infected Elite by the Shade which almost everyone must've noticed by now, I noticed two other infected Elites to the right up above in an area you can't access unless you jump on top of the Pelican at the start of the level. I fired several rounds at one them with the Pistol, and I think I killed it or just downed him (this was on Easy by the way, because I just wanted to look at a few things). If you want to see these infected Elites yourself, watch for yellow dots very carefully on the motion tracker and look in their direction; they go quickly. Now, also on the right of the makeshift bridge is a pipe and piece of level you can walk up that will take you to a bush with Active Camouflage inside of it. Now here's something; the Camo is absolutely useless as there are pretty much no enemies to neutralise (sure there are Grunts and Jackals, but after all they're just Grunts and Jackals).

There's something else too; the cutscene continuously screws up the characters of Mendoza and Jenkins. Because the Marines (except for Stacker and Johnson, in some cases at least) are randomly generated, they don't really have any identity. Jenkins sounds a lot like both Mendoza and Bisenti, now at the start of the cutscene Mendoza is talking to Jenkins, then when Chief fast forwards we see Mendoza commenting on a dead Elite, despite that it's Jenkins' voice coming from his mouth, this happens again when Mendoza is unlocking the door.

Last thing; this cutscene is in real-time, at the start when they are in the Pelican, you can see a Flood Infection Spore jump at the camera for a split-second (you just see the tentacles and tendrils, but it's a Spore all right), next is when the Marines are ambushed. Mendoza, Johnson and Keyes are the only people who open fire (there are two other Marines but they just seem to stand there to the right of Jenkins), it's funny how they just fire at the ceiling randomly, and sometimes the Spores don't even attack they just run around or stand there.

There's a few things that intrigue me about this level, its layout is huge but you only explore a small amount (if you stay with the Marines at the end of the level, you can sometimes go beyond the tower where you are meant to be picked up).

I swear this works: Right before you jump out of the Pelican, start chunking grenades as fast as you can. You get stuck inside the Pelican. Stay inside (you can jump out whenever you want by pressing b x) until the the ship lands. It'll land on some higher ground behind where you start. Then explore the terrain. If I were you, I would go down the hill behind the Pelican (stay on the cliff area away from regular ground) and go straight. Whoever finds the Lost Marine first let me know! (Turn your light on you can see him better)

ps. Trust me about the grenade thing. If it doesnt work the first time, restart level and keep trying!
